On Saturday 22 June, I'm taking part in Pendleside Hospice's "Velocity 2 Zip Line 2024" challenge!

Velocity 2 is the fastest zip line in the world and the longest in Europe; it's located at Zip World near Bethesda, North Wales.

Top speed is over 100mph over 1,555 metres.

Pendleside Hospice is a not-for-profit organisation which exists to provide services that enhance the quality of life for local people living with advancing, long term and life limiting illnesses, through to end of life and in bereavement. Pendleside expects to incur total running costs of around £5.5 million during financial year 2023/2024. With approximately 22% of these costs being funded through NHS grants, the charity needs to raise around £4.3 million from other sources in order to cover the balance of anticipated annual expenses.
